I liked the structure of the documentary. We get a definition of the problem, first-hand experiences, discussions about where the problem comes from, examples of how women have managed to create lasting change, and reasons why we should all care. Overall, it presents a good basis for discussion/action, regardless on how familiar you are with the topic.

Also, the protagonists are truly inspiring. Especially when they share their thoughts on how they navigate and respond to inappropriate behavior on a daily basis. As a white male, I have never had to think about these things - and I completely agree with some of the statements in the documentary: It is a complete waste of brilliant minds.

Because it is US-centric, it prompts me to look at how things are elsewhere. I hope to find at least progress.
